Case Study: Lone Worker Protection in a Health Centre
Community health centres often require staff to conduct home visits alone, sometimes in unfamiliar or unpredictable environments. This raised concerns about their safety, especially if they encountered aggression, accidents, or sudden health emergencies while working independently.
To address this, the centre implemented SentriCore lone worker alarms. These wearable devices included automatic fall and inactivity detection, ensuring an alert was raised even if the user was incapacitated. Signals were routed to the central control unit, which immediately notified designated colleagues via phone and pager.
The system was installed quickly without specialist IT resources or subscriptions, making it a cost-effective solution. Staff appreciated the simple, plug-and-play functionality, knowing they were supported wherever they went.
Since rollout, incidents have been handled faster, lone workers feel safer, and management has a clear audit trail of every alert for compliance and accountability. The system reinforced staff wellbeing and reduced workplace anxiety significantly.
